Spectra GL1425C

The Spectra GL1425C is a rugged dual grade laser designed for accurate horizontal, vertical, and grade levelling. Featuring built-in Bluetooth for smartphone control, an 800m range, and Grade Match capability with the HL760 receiver, it delivers reliable performance for demanding construction and civil engineering projects.

  • Integrated Bluetooth: Control all laser and grade functions via the Spectra Laser Remote App on your smartphone.
  • Automatic Grade Match: Wirelessly connects to the HL760 receiver to automatically calculate and display unknown grades.
  • Dual-Axis Capability: Delivers precise horizontal, vertical, and dual-grade levelling with a +/- 15% grade range.
  • Ruggedized Performance: IP66-rated housing that survives 1m drops onto concrete and 1.5m tripod tip-overs.
  • 800m Working Range: High-speed rotation up to 900 RPM provides a massive 2,600 ft diameter coverage area.

What is “Fingerprinting” and why is it useful with the HL760 receiver?
Fingerprinting technology allows the receiver to only “talk” to the specific laser it is paired with. This is crucial on busy sites with multiple lasers, as it prevents your receiver from picking up stray signals from other teams’ equipment.

How long is the battery life for a standard working week?
The GL1425C offers up to 45 hours of continuous use with its NiMH battery pack, generally covering a full week on one charge. The unit can also be used while charging or swapped to standard alkaline batteries to keep the job moving.

What is the “PlaneLok” feature and how does it prevent errors?
PlaneLok “locks” the laser beam onto a fixed point on the receiver. If the beam drifts due to wind, temperature, or tripod settlement, the laser automatically adjusts back to the original position, providing “set-and-forget” security for high-accuracy grading.

In which scenarios should I choose the GL1425C over a standard horizontal laser?
The GL1425C is engineered for precision grading with a range of -10% to +15% across both axes. This makes it essential for complex drainage runs, car park falls, and sports field construction where dual-slope accuracy is non-negotiable.

How does the “Grade Match” feature assist with existing site slopes?
Grade Match allows the laser to automatically search for the receiver and calculate the existing grade between two points. It is perfect for matching new work to existing road surfaces or driveways without manual calculations.

Can the GL1425C be used for vertical alignment and building layout?
Yes, the GL1425C features vertical self-levelling and dual 5/8-11 threads. It can be used for vertical plumb transfers, string-line alignment, and squaring off foundations, offering a single-instrument solution for groundworks and structural phases.

How rugged is the GL1425C for typical UK site environments?
The GL1425C can survive a 1-metre drop onto concrete or a 1.5-metre tripod tip-over. Its IP66 rating ensures it is dust-tight and protected against heavy rain, which is vital for maintaining productivity during UK winter months.
